    I’m going to NY shortly and while I’ve been many times before, this time, instead of leaving on a Saturday in all peace and calm, after my meeting finishes at 5.30 pm on a Friday I’ll be heading straight to Newark for my 8.30 pm Lufthansa flight.

    Can anyone advise on the best way to get there in good time as I guess the rush hour will be in full swing?

    I would always take the train from Penn Station if I was in a similar situation as at least you can be certain you will avoid the rush hour traffic leaving Manhattan to NJ. The trains are super frequent and normally take 30-35mins, then it is a short air-train over to terminal B for your departure…

    I have taken various car services/flagged cabs to newark from manhattan and it really does depend on traffic. Normally 35-40minutes… however the only reason I suggested the train was that once I left manhattan at approx 530pm on a friday in a cab to newark and I actually missed my flight due to traffic (albeit flight was at 730pm so you have an extra hour) as the traffic through the tunnel and toll was virtually standstill… on that occasion if I had just gone to penn and taken a train I would have definitely made the flight! However I am pretty sure if you leave at 530 in a cab you will get there in good enough time for an 830 flight.
